Output 8fb75abaa4c89528eeb4ea18d18c6917e54fdb3dd366768446176914ec9f8ac9:1

value
35259
script pubkey
OP_0 OP_PUSHBYTES_20 d56814de923e0a8388ecb1f86f0576bb192f4bd6
address
bc1q645pfh5j8c9g8z8vk8ux7ptkhvvj7j7k909w6q
transaction
8fb75abaa4c89528eeb4ea18d18c6917e54fdb3dd366768446176914ec9f8ac9
confirmations
78939
spent
true